There are young children with developmental disabilities, with physical disabilities, with autism, with a whole spectrum of needs for whom, if you don't get them into quality child care early, professionals don't have the capacity to provide services to help them develop and attain the highest quality of life and performance in their lives.
That's another reason that structured and regulated child care is so critical. It's to make sure that the most vulnerable children in our communities get the additional support they couldn't get from their families but need in order to live full lives.
